English Meaning & Definitions
A secondary covering attached to the exterior wall of a building or over a window/door, typically made of canvas or vinyl, used to provide shelter from the sun or rain.
- “We sat at the sidewalk cafe under the striped green awning to escape the midday heat.”
- “The store owner rolled down the canvas awning before locking up for the night.”

Originating in the mid-17th century, possibly from the older nautical term 'awm' (canopy or covering over a ship's deck), of uncertain ultimate origin, though some linguists suggest a connection to Old Norse or Germanic roots related to coverings or roofs.
